[Pkg-puppet-devel] Bug#514405: puppetmaster: Puppet::Parser::Compiler failed with error NameError

Vincent Bernat bernat at luffy.cx
Sat Feb 7 09:35:33 UTC 2009


Package: puppetmaster
Version: 0.24.5-3
Severity: important

Hi!

After uprading to puppetmaster into lenny, I get this:
err: Puppet::Parser::Compiler failed with error NameError:
uninitialized constant ParamValue on node XXXXXXX

Here is the complete trace:
/usr/lib/ruby/1.8/puppet/parser/interpreter.rb:32:in compile'
/usr/lib/ruby/1.8/puppet/indirector/catalog/compiler.rb:68:in compile'
/usr/lib/ruby/1.8/puppet/util.rb:212:in benchmark'
/usr/lib/ruby/1.8/active_support/core_ext/benchmark.rb:8:in realtime'
/usr/lib/ruby/1.8/puppet/util.rb:211:in benchmark'
/usr/lib/ruby/1.8/puppet/indirector/catalog/compiler.rb:66:in compile'
/usr/lib/ruby/1.8/puppet/indirector/catalog/compiler.rb:21:in find'
/usr/lib/ruby/1.8/puppet/indirector/indirection.rb:210:in find'
/usr/lib/ruby/1.8/puppet/indirector.rb:49:in find'
/usr/lib/ruby/1.8/puppet/network/handler/master.rb:65:in getconfig'
/usr/lib/ruby/1.8/active_support/inflector.rb:283:in to_proc'
/usr/lib/ruby/1.8/puppet/network/xmlrpc/processor.rb:52:in call'
/usr/lib/ruby/1.8/puppet/network/xmlrpc/processor.rb:52:in
protect_service'
/usr/lib/ruby/1.8/puppet/network/xmlrpc/processor.rb:85:in
setup_processor'
/usr/lib/ruby/1.8/xmlrpc/server.rb:336:in call'
/usr/lib/ruby/1.8/xmlrpc/server.rb:336:in dispatch'
/usr/lib/ruby/1.8/xmlrpc/server.rb:323:in each'
/usr/lib/ruby/1.8/xmlrpc/server.rb:323:in dispatch'
/usr/lib/ruby/1.8/xmlrpc/server.rb:366:in call_method'
/usr/lib/ruby/1.8/xmlrpc/server.rb:378:in handle'
/usr/lib/ruby/1.8/puppet/network/xmlrpc/processor.rb:44:in process'
/usr/lib/ruby/1.8/puppet/network/xmlrpc/webrick_servlet.rb:68:in
service'
/usr/lib/ruby/1.8/webrick/httpserver.rb:104:in service'
/usr/lib/ruby/1.8/webrick/httpserver.rb:65:in run'
/usr/lib/ruby/1.8/webrick/server.rb:173:in start_thread'
/usr/lib/ruby/1.8/webrick/server.rb:162:in start'
/usr/lib/ruby/1.8/webrick/server.rb:162:in start_thread'
/usr/lib/ruby/1.8/webrick/server.rb:95:in start'
/usr/lib/ruby/1.8/webrick/server.rb:92:in each'
/usr/lib/ruby/1.8/webrick/server.rb:92:in start'
/usr/lib/ruby/1.8/webrick/server.rb:23:in start'
/usr/lib/ruby/1.8/webrick/server.rb:82:in start'
/usr/lib/ruby/1.8/puppet.rb:293:in start'
/usr/lib/ruby/1.8/puppet.rb:144:in newthread'
/usr/lib/ruby/1.8/puppet.rb:143:in initialize'
/usr/lib/ruby/1.8/puppet.rb:143:in new'
/usr/lib/ruby/1.8/puppet.rb:143:in newthread'
/usr/lib/ruby/1.8/puppet.rb:291:in start'
/usr/lib/ruby/1.8/puppet.rb:290:in each'
/usr/lib/ruby/1.8/puppet.rb:290:in start'
/usr/sbin/puppetmasterd:285
err: Puppet::Parser::Compiler failed with error NameError:
uninitialized constant ParamValue on node merry.luffy.cx

It seems to be the same bug as:
 http://projects.reductivelabs.com/issues/show/1518

-- System Information:
Debian Release: 5.0
  APT prefers testing
  APT policy: (500, 'testing')
Architecture: amd64 (x86_64)

Kernel: Linux 2.6.22.19-vs (SMP w/2 CPU cores)
Locale: LANG=POSIX, LC_CTYPE=POSIX (charmap=ANSI_X3.4-1968)
Shell: /bin/sh linked to /bin/bash

Versions of packages puppetmaster depends on:
ii  facter                        1.5.1-0.1  a library for retrieving facts fro
ii  lsb-base                      3.2-20     Linux Standard Base 3.2 init scrip
ii  puppet                        0.24.5-3   centralised configuration manageme
ii  ruby                          4.2        An interpreter of object-oriented 

Versions of packages puppetmaster recommends:
ii  rails                         2.1.0-6    MVC ruby based framework geared fo
ii  rdoc                          4.2        Generate documentation from ruby s

Versions of packages puppetmaster suggests:
pn  apache2 | nginx               <none>     (no description available)
pn  mongrel                       <none>     (no description available)

-- debconf-show failed





More information about the Pkg-puppet-devel mailing list